High-quality nylon nut milk bag Making your own nut milk is actually quite simple. Hazelnuts, almonds, macadamia nuts, cashews and even sesame or hemp seeds (shelled or unshelled) are all suitable. We stock a wide range of natural and sprouted nuts. The best thing is to just give it a go – the proof is in the pudding! Advantages and disadvantages of fresh nut milk Freshly made nut milk isn’t just delicious, it’s also a source of vitamins, minerals, enzymes, unsaturated fatty acids and antioxidants. As fresh nut milk contains no additives and is unpasteurised, it goes off after just 24 hours in the fridge. We therefore recommend only making small quantities at a time. Origin of the nut milk bag The high-quality Naturkostbarnut milk bag comes from a small business in Arizona. Two friends – Karla and Elaina – developed and sewed the first nut milk bag here in 1999 for their raw food events. In doing so, they simplified the process of making nut milk, as the dripping and the hassle of using cheesecloth were, understandably, too fiddly for them. With great care and high standards of quality, Karla has been crafting these premium nut milk bags in her workshop ever since. Elaina’s company distributes the products. What material is the nut milk bag made of? The nut milk bag is made from nylon. How do I use the nut milk bag? To make nut milk: Soak one to two cups of nuts overnight in fresh water. During soaking, enzymes (phytases) are produced which break down the phytic acid, making the nuts easier to digest. Pour away the soaking water and rinse the nuts briefly. Blend the nuts with 2–3 cups of fresh water.The more powerful the blender, the better. Strain the blended mixture through the nut milk bag into a saucepan and squeeze gently. You can dry the fibre left in the nut milk bag and process it into nut flour using a blender. Pack the flour in an airtight container and store it in the fridge. It makes a high-fibre ingredient for cakes, biscuits, crêpes, etc.

Recipe for 120g of chocolate 90g organic cocoa paste, finely chopped 15g organic cocoa butter, finely chopped 20g organic agave syrup A pinch each of Himalayan salt and vanilla powder Your favourite superfoods such as goji berries, mulberries, coconut flakes, cashew nuts, pine nuts and many more. Let your creativity run wild and try out new combinations. Combinations such as fruity-sweet, sweet-sour, salty-sweet and nutty-sweet are particularly exciting. You can find more delicious recipes on ourSamaraNatura recipes page, by the way. Method Slowly melt the cocoa paste and cocoa butter together in a saucepan over the lowest heat. Add the remaining ingredients, stir well, leave to cool slightly, pour into a mould and decorate with your favourite superfoods. Will keep in the fridge for around 2 months. Using the mould 1. After decorating the chocolates, leave the filled mould to cool in the fridge for about 20 minutes. The chocolate must no longer be soft but must have set completely. Otherwise, it will break when you try to remove it and you’ll end up with broken chocolate. 2. To remove the chocolates, simply bend the mould slightly. This should cause the bars to come away on their own, and you can tip them onto a plate. 3. Wrap them in suitable cling film and paper sleeves. Notes: Dimensions approx. 5 x 13 cm. Advantages of glass sprouting units Health and safety: Glass is an inert material that does not release any harmful chemicals or toxins. When sprouting food, it is important that it does not come into contact with harmful substances to ensure the quality and health of the sprouts and sprouted food. Sustainability: Glass is an environmentally friendly material that is recyclable and reusable. Using glass sprouting equipment helps to reduce the ecological footprint and pave the way to a more sustainable future. Durability: Glass is generally more durable and resistant. It retains its original shape and transparency over a longer period of time without discolouring or deforming. This means that glass sterilisers retain their functionality and aesthetics even after frequent use and many sterilisation processes. No odour absorption or discolouration: Glass does not absorb odours or flavours, so it does not cause any undesirable changes in the taste of the sprouted food. In addition, glass does not discolour, so it retains its clear and attractive appearance. Hygiene: Glass is easier to clean and has a smooth, non-porous surface on which fewer bacteria can colonise. This makes it easier to clean glass sterilisers thoroughly and ensure a high level of hygiene, which is particularly important when it comes to food.
